OSError: Cannot load native module 'Crypto.Cipher._raw_ecb' #21

Description

@sdaau

Just downloaded streamlink-portable-2.1.1-py3.6.5-amd64.zip, unpacked the streamlink folder inside in C:\bin.

Tried this, then, on Windows 10 Home 64-bit:

C:\>cd C:\bin\streamlink

C:\bin\streamlink>streamlink.bat
Traceback (most recent call last):
  File "C:\bin\streamlink\\streamlink-script.py", line 11, in <module>
    from streamlink_cli.main import main
  File "C:\bin\streamlink\packages\streamlink_cli\main.py", line 25, in <module>
    from streamlink.stream import StreamProcess
  File "C:\bin\streamlink\packages\streamlink\stream\__init__.py", line 5, in <module>
    from streamlink.stream.hls import HLSStream
  File "C:\bin\streamlink\packages\streamlink\stream\hls.py", line 8, in <module>
    from Crypto.Cipher import AES
  File "C:\bin\streamlink\packages\Crypto\Cipher\__init__.py", line 27, in <module>
    from Crypto.Cipher._mode_ecb import _create_ecb_cipher
  File "C:\bin\streamlink\packages\Crypto\Cipher\_mode_ecb.py", line 47, in <module>
    """
  File "C:\bin\streamlink\packages\Crypto\Util\_raw_api.py", line 297, in load_pycryptodome_raw_lib
    raise OSError("Cannot load native module '%s': %s" % (name, ", ".join(attempts)))
OSError: Cannot load native module 'Crypto.Cipher._raw_ecb': Trying '_raw_ecb.cp36-win_amd64.pyd': [WinError 126] The specified module could not be found, Trying '_raw_ecb.pyd': [WinError 193] %1 is not a valid Win32 application

C:\bin\streamlink>

Not sure what the problem is ... Ah, i guess this - in MSYS2 bash terminal:

$ find packages/Crypto/ -name '*ecb*'
packages/Crypto/Cipher/_mode_ecb.py
packages/Crypto/Cipher/_mode_ecb.pyi
packages/Crypto/Cipher/_raw_ecb.pyd
packages/Crypto/Cipher/__pycache__/_mode_ecb.cpython-36.pyc

$ file packages/Crypto/Cipher/_raw_ecb.pyd
packages/Crypto/Cipher/_raw_ecb.pyd: PE32 executable (DLL) (GUI) Intel 80386, for MS Windows

So, the .pyd is 32-bit - but as this is a 64-build, maybe that is the problem?

Tried deleting, byt .pyd does not get reconstructed automatically:

OSError: Cannot load native module 'Crypto.Cipher._raw_ecb': Trying '_raw_ecb.cp36-win_amd64.pyd': [WinError 126] The specified module could not be found, Trying '_raw_ecb.pyd': [WinError 126] The specified module could not be found

Well, at least no more of "is not a valid Win32 application" ...


EDIT: tried latest nightly, streamlink-portable-2.1.1+9.g44d4afa-py3.7.9-amd64.zip - that one seems to work:

C:\bin\streamlink>streamlink.bat
usage: streamlink [OPTIONS] <URL> [STREAM]

Use -h/--help to see the available options or read the manual at https://streamlink.github.io

So, that's good - I'm OK, but I'll leave the bug open, since as I understood it, streamlink-portable-2.1.1-py3.6.5-amd64.zip is still official stable release, and it seems it is broken.
